Passenger Sentenced For Fatal Stabbing Of Driver After Argument In Westchester A 39-year-old man will spend time behind bars after being found guilty of the fatal stabbing of another man in a parked car following a three-week trial in Westchester. Byron Stinson, of Yonkers, was found guilty in Westchester of second-degree manslaughter and criminal possession of a weapon, both felonies, for his role in the 2019 stabbing death of another man while the two were doing drugs. On Friday, Oct. 1, Westchester County District Attorney Mimi Rocah announced that Stinson has been sentenced to a term of 7.5 years to 15 years in state prison. “A life was needlessly lost the n…

Acquaintance In Custody After Fatal Stabbing In Westchester A suspect is in police custody after a fatal overnight stabbing in Westchester. At approximately 4:35 a.m. on Wednesday, April 24, members of the Yonkers Police Department responded to the area in front of 26 Vineyard Ave. on a report of an injured man bleeding from the throat. Upon arrival officers discovered the man down in the street bleeding from an apparent stab wound to the neck, said Yonkers Police, adding that first responders immediately rendered medical aid to the victim, who succumbed to his injury and was pronounced dead at scene.
